The useless scraps of red tape, spurious documentation, signatures, human signatories, telephone messages, Post-It(TM) notes, faxes, LOIs, MOUs and other detritus that are necessary in order to navigate a needlessly bureaucratic organization.
"Bring that stack of bureaucrap to the vendor meeting. Corporate Counsel needs to know that we dotted our "i"s on this one."

The large amount of unnecessary paperwork generated by a government agency that litters the desks, offices, and email accounts of anyone who conducts business with them.

Usually consists of copious amounts of forms to get permission to fill out other forms that require multiple levels of approval along with original signatures of individuals who are on vacation for a duration of which negates the original intent of completing the form.
John D. compiled a large amount of bureaucrap on his desk in a desperate attempt to notify the Army Corps of Engineers that concrete will in fact get hard when water is added.

(verb) The act of putting an idea, proposal or document through examination by a bureaucracy or bureaucratically minded administrator.
"I had a great idea but I don't know what it'll look like once management gets done bureaucrapping all over it."

A lazy, paper-shuffling government worker. Bureaucrap's main duty is spending all money they are allotted by any means necessary, then asking for more the next fiscal year. Bureaucraps perpetuate the problems they are assigned to solve, as this is job security.
Upon realizing there was still $200,000 in the department's budget, bureaucrap Dan successfully arranged five seminars dealing with "Diversity in a Mid-Level Management Paradigm."
